Lemoyne, OH demographics:
population, income, and more
Lemoyne population
How many people live in Lemoyne
Lemoyne is home to 116 residents, according to the most recent Census data. Gender-wise, 50% of Lemoyne locals are male, and 49.1% are female.
Age demographics
The median age in Lemoyne is 40, with the population distributed as follows: about 18.3% are children under 15, then 12.2% are in the 15 to 24 age group. Adults between 25 and 44 make up 27% of the population, while another 24.4% fall into the 45 to 64 bracket. Finally, around 18.3% are 65 or older.
Racial makeup
In Lemoyne, 93.1% of the population are US-born citizens, while 4.3% have gained naturalized citizenship. At the same time, 2.6% of residents are non-citizens. As for race, 86.1% of locals are Caucasian, 1.7% are African American and 4.4% have Asian roots. There’s also a share of 7% that includes residents with two or more races.
Households in Lemoyne
A peek inside Lemoyne households
Lemoyne has 49 households, with an average of 2 members in each. Of these, 61.2% are families, while the remaining 38.8% are made up of individuals living alone or with non-relatives, such as roommates.

Housing in Lemoyne
The housing landscape of Lemoyne
Lemoyne's housing consists of 51 units, with 59.6% being detached single-family homes ideal for those wanting space. Attached options, including duplexes and townhouses, make up 5.8% and offer a more compact, shared living style. Then there are the multifamily buildings in the area, and for those seeking flexibility, non-traditional options like mobile homes account for 5.8% of the housing landscape.
The age of buildings in Lemoyne
In Lemoyne, the median construction year is 1990. About 7.7% of homes were built before the 1940s, with another 1.9% going up by 1949. Most development happened in the second half of the 20th century. Then, 17.3% of homes were added from 2000 to 2009, 15.4% between 2010 and 2019, and 1.9% are part of the newest wave of development.
Lemoyne occupancy rates
Out of the 49 occupied housing units in Lemoyne, 65.3% are owner-occupied, while 34.7% are lived in by tenants. Meanwhile, 3.9% of all homes on the local market sit vacant.
Lemoyne housing costs
Housing costs in Lemoyne come to a median of $1,415 per month, while tenants specifically pay a median gross rent of $1,199.
Education in Lemoyne
Lemoyne education at a glance
About 23.6% of the population in Lemoyne went to high school, while 20.2% pursued college studies. Another 9% earned an associate degree and 27% hold a bachelor’s. Meanwhile, 19.1% went even further, earning a master’s or doctorate.
Income in Lemoyne
How much people earn in Lemoyne
The average annual household income in Lemoyne was $137,744 in 2024, the most recent annual data available,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. This marked a +3.9% change from the previous year. At the same time, the median income stood at $95,846, reflecting a +4.8% shift over the same period.
Lemoyne income by age
In Lemoyne, households led by residents aged 25 to 44 — usually in the early to mid stages of their careers — have a median income of $109,468. Those with someone between 45 and 64 in charge, often well established professionally, earn $127,609 overall. Younger households, where the main provider is under 25 and just starting out, report a median income of $60,577, while those led by someone over 65, many of whom may be retired, have about $62,636 in earnings. Overall, 93.8% of the locals in this community live above the poverty line.
Employment in Lemoyne
Workforce and job types in Lemoyne
83.3% of the working population are employed in professional or administrative positions, while 16.7% are in hands-on or service-based jobs. Also, 8.3% run their own businesses, 66.7% are employed by private companies, and 13.3% work in the public sector.

Data source & methodology
The demographic data on this page was sourced from the latest U.S. Census Bureau release—the 2019–2023 American Community Survey (ACS) 5-year estimates.
